Ag0.610Mg0.390 is a silver-magnesium intermetallic compound or solid solution alloy combining a precious metal (silver) with a lightweight base metal (magnesium) in a fixed stoichiometric or near-equilibrium ratio. This material exists primarily in research and exploratory development contexts rather than as an established commercial alloy, positioning it at the intersection of lightweight metallurgy and electrical/thermal conductivity needs. The combination of silver's excellent conductivity and corrosion resistance with magnesium's low density and cost structure suggests potential applications in specialized aerospace, electronics, or high-performance thermal management systems where weight reduction and electrical properties must be balanced.
